QSslCertificate: support expiration dates > 2049
X509 has two time formats: UTC, where the year is in two-digit format, and generalized time with four-digit years. This patch allows dates specified generalized time. Reviewed-by: Thiago Macieira Task-number: QTBUG-12489 (cherry picked from commit a77dbcdbb7022cc754ba87aea9a4fc471d1e4495)
